Improved public access for the Archives of Iowa Broadcasting through the cataloging of 28,000 items and digitization of over 2,000 broadcast tapes from KWWL-TV, a flagship public news station in eastern Iowa. The collection documents the history and development of community radio and television in the state and includes oral histories, documents, photographs, and artifacts dating from 1922 to 2007.

The Archives of Iowa Broadcasting (AIB) contains oral histories, documents, photographs, promotional materials, artifacts and over 28,000 audiovisual recordings (1922-2007) that document the history and development of radio and television in Iowa. These represent a unique body of records all too often lost due to the ephemeral nature of original broadcasts and the degradation and obsolescence of the media carriers that captured them. This grant project would create an online media catalog of the more than 28,000 items in the AIB audiovisual collection. The grant would also involve digitization of 2,230 videotapes of broadcast footage from KWWL-TV, a flagship news station in eastern Iowa. Digitizing these materials will allow for their preservation.  The files will be made available online through the media catalog. Creating an online catalog of Iowa Broadcasting materials and beginning to digitize our fragile media holdings are essential to expanding future use of the AIB collection.
